DOCUMENTATION = '''
|
|
module: openshift_v1_route
|
|
short_description: OpenShift Route
|
|
description:
|
|
- Manage the lifecycle of a route object. Supports check mode, and attempts to to
|
|
be idempotent.
|
|
version_added: 2.3.0
|
|
author: OpenShift (@openshift)
|
|
options:
|
|
annotations: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Annotations is an unstructured key value map stored with a resource that may
|
|
be set by external tools to store and retrieve arbitrary metadata. They are
|
|
not queryable and should be preserved when modifying objects.
|
|
type: dict
|
|
api_key: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Token used to connect to the API.
|
|
cert_file: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Path to a certificate used to authenticate with the API.
|
|
type: path
|
|
context:
|
|
description:
|
|
- The name of a context found in the Kubernetes config file.
|
|
debug: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Enable debug output from the OpenShift helper. Logging info is written to KubeObjHelper.log
|
|
default: false
|
|
type: bool
|
|
force:
|
|
description:
|
|
- If set to C(True), and I(state) is C(present), an existing object will updated,
|
|
and lists will be replaced, rather than merged.
|
|
default: false
|
|
type: bool
|
|
host: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Provide a URL for acessing the Kubernetes API.
|
|
key_file: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Path to a key file used to authenticate with the API.
|
|
type: path
|
|
kubeconfig: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Path to an existing Kubernetes config file. If not provided, and no other connection
|
|
options are provided, the openshift client will attempt to load the default
|
|
configuration file from I(~/.kube/config.json).
|
|
type: path
|
|
labels: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Map of string keys and values that can be used to organize and categorize (scope
|
|
and select) objects. May match selectors of replication controllers and services.
|
|
type: dict
|
|
name: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Name must be unique within a namespace. Is required when creating resources,
|
|
although some resources may allow a client to request the generation of an appropriate
|
|
name automatically. Name is primarily intended for creation idempotence and
|
|
configuration definition. Cannot be updated.
|
|
namespace: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Namespace defines the space within each name must be unique. An empty namespace
|
|
is equivalent to the "default" namespace, but "default" is the canonical representation.
|
|
Not all objects are required to be scoped to a namespace - the value of this
|
|
field for those objects will be empty. Must be a DNS_LABEL. Cannot be updated.
|
|
password: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Provide a password for connecting to the API. Use in conjunction with I(username).
|
|
resource_definition: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Provide the YAML definition for the object, bypassing any modules parameters
|
|
intended to define object attributes.
|
|
type: dict
|
|
spec_alternate_backends:
|
|
description:
|
|
- alternateBackends allows up to 3 additional backends to be assigned to the route.
|
|
Only the Service kind is allowed, and it will be defaulted to Service. Use the
|
|
weight field in RouteTargetReference object to specify relative preference.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- alternate_backends
|
|
type: list
|
|
spec_host:
|
|
description:
|
|
- host is an alias/DNS that points to the service. Optional. If not specified
|
|
a route name will typically be automatically chosen. Must follow DNS952 subdomain
|
|
conventions.
|
|
spec_path: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Path that the router watches for, to route traffic for to the service. Optional
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- path
|
|
spec_port_target_port:
|
|
description:
|
|
- The target port on pods selected by the service this route points to. If this
|
|
is a string, it will be looked up as a named port in the target endpoints port
|
|
list. Required
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- port_target_port
|
|
type: object
|
|
spec_tls_ca_certificate:
|
|
description:
|
|
- caCertificate provides the cert authority certificate contents
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_ca_certificate
|
|
spec_tls_certificate:
|
|
description:
|
|
- certificate provides certificate contents
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_certificate
|
|
spec_tls_destination_ca_certificate:
|
|
description:
|
|
- destinationCACertificate provides the contents of the ca certificate of the
|
|
final destination. When using reencrypt termination this file should be provided
|
|
in order to have routers use it for health checks on the secure connection.
|
|
If this field is not specified, the router may provide its own destination CA
|
|
and perform hostname validation using the short service name (service.namespace.svc),
|
|
which allows infrastructure generated certificates to automatically verify.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_destination_ca_certificate
|
|
spec_tls_insecure_edge_termination_policy:
|
|
description:
|
|
- insecureEdgeTerminationPolicy indicates the desired behavior for insecure connections
|
|
to a route. While each router may make its own decisions on which ports to expose,
|
|
this is normally port 80. * Allow - traffic is sent to the server on the insecure
|
|
port (default) * Disable - no traffic is allowed on the insecure port. * Redirect
|
|
- clients are redirected to the secure port.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_insecure_edge_termination_policy
|
|
spec_tls_key:
|
|
description:
|
|
- key provides key file contents
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_key
|
|
spec_tls_termination:
|
|
description:
|
|
- termination indicates termination type.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- tls_termination
|
|
spec_to_kind:
|
|
description:
|
|
- The kind of target that the route is referring to. Currently, only 'Service'
|
|
is allowed
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- to_kind
|
|
spec_to_name:
|
|
description:
|
|
- name of the service/target that is being referred to. e.g. name of the service
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- to_name
|
|
spec_to_weight:
|
|
description:
|
|
- weight as an integer between 0 and 256, default 1, that specifies the target's
|
|
relative weight against other target reference objects. 0 suppresses requests
|
|
to this backend.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- to_weight
|
|
type: int
|
|
spec_wildcard_policy: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Wildcard policy if any for the route. Currently only 'Subdomain' or 'None' is
|
|
allowed.
|
|
aliases:
|
|
- wildcard_policy
|
|
src: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Provide a path to a file containing the YAML definition of the object. Mutually
|
|
exclusive with I(resource_definition).
|
|
type: path
|
|
ssl_ca_cert: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Path to a CA certificate used to authenticate with the API.
|
|
type: path
|
|
state: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Determines if an object should be created, patched, or deleted. When set to
|
|
C(present), the object will be created, if it does not exist, or patched, if
|
|
parameter values differ from the existing object's attributes, and deleted,
|
|
if set to C(absent). A patch operation results in merging lists and updating
|
|
dictionaries, with lists being merged into a unique set of values. If a list
|
|
contains a dictionary with a I(name) or I(type) attribute, a strategic merge
|
|
is performed, where individual elements with a matching I(name_) or I(type)
|
|
are merged. To force the replacement of lists, set the I(force) option to C(True).
|
|
default: present
|
|
choices:
|
|
- present
|
|
- absent
|
|
username: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Provide a username for connecting to the API.
|
|
verify_ssl:
|
|
description:
|
|
- Whether or not to verify the API server's SSL certificates.
|
|
type: bool
|
|
requirements:
|
|
- openshift == 0.4.0
|
|
'''
